2011-08-24 54 views
1

沒有人知道如果我有一個腳本會發生什麼?_escaped_fragment_ =一個返回一個鏈接到#!b(因此,它將成爲腳本?_escaped_fragment_ = A#!b)?谷歌+ AJAX/_escaped_fragment_

將谷歌嘗試訪問腳本?_escaped_fragment_ = b

+0

你在說什麼? –

+0

谷歌爬蟲處理AJAX內容的方式:http://code.google.com/web/ajaxcrawling/docs/getting-started.html – Lem0n

+0

您是否找到了解決此問題的方法?到處是絕對鏈接的解決方案?我們正面臨同樣的挑戰。 – user85155

回答

1

否 - Googlbot不會抓取該鏈接。根據Google規範,Googlebot不會抓取您網站上包含_escaped_fragment_的網址。

0

我不喜歡這樣寫道:

RewriteCond %{QUERY_STRING} ^_escaped_fragment_=(.*)$ 
    RewriteCond %{REQUEST_URI} !^/snapshots/views/ [NC] 
    RewriteRule ^(.*)/?$ /snapshots/views/%1 [L]